North Marston is Britain's most foot pathed village providing many walks and adventures through the surrounding countryside. Although its records date back to Roman times, by far the most significant period in the village’s history was in the 14th and 15th centuries, when, for almost 200 years, North Marston became one of the most important and famous places for religious pilgrimage in the country, being visited by more pilgrims than any other site except Canterbury and Walsingham, and the name “North Marston” was recognised throughout the land.
